The Goa Science Center & Planetarium, Goa 🧪⛱️ Where Science Meets Fun and Learning The Goa Science Centre & Planetarium, nestled on New Marine Highway in Miramar, Panjim, is a delightful hub for science enthusiasts of all ages. Established in 2001 as a collaborative project between the National Council of Science Museums and Goa's Department of Science, Technology & Environment, it spans 5 acres of interactive exhibits and educational fun. Visiting the Goa Science Centre is a joy ride through the realms of physics, astronomy, and marine science. The center houses two thematic galleries: Fun Science and Science of Oceans, offering hands-on exhibits where you can test your strength with pulleys or experience the mysteries of the deep sea. If you're visiting with kids, they will particularly enjoy the Mirror Magic Gallery and the outdoor Science Park, where learning through play is the mantra. The digital planetarium is a highlight, with shows scheduled at 11:00 AM, 1:00 PM, 3:00 PM, and 5:00 PM, taking you on a cosmic journey through the stars. For a bit of extra thrill, don’t miss the 3D shows, available at 10:30 AM, 12:30 PM, 2:30 PM, and 4:30 PM. These shows are not just for kids; adults often find themselves equally captivated. The Science Centre operates daily from 10:00 AM to 6:00 PM, except during Diwali and Holi. Entry is reasonably priced at INR 50 for adults and INR 30 for children. Special shows, such as the planetarium or 3D shows, cost an additional INR 15 per head. Interestingly, the center isn't just about exhibits. It hosts a variety of educational programs and workshops aimed at igniting scientific curiosity among visitors. Events like Science Demonstration Lectures and Astro Night Tourism are regular features on their calendar. So, whether you’re a science buff or just looking for an educational day out with family, the Goa Science Centre & Planetarium is a must-visit. And if you're worried about missing out on the beach vibes, don't fret—Miramar Beach is just a short stroll away, allowing you to seamlessly blend learning with leisure.

My recent visit to the Goa Science Centre and Planetarium was nothing short of captivating! This scientific haven nestled in the heart of Goa offers an enriching experience for visitors of all ages. The Science Centre boasts an array of interactive exhibits that make learning a fun and engaging activity. From physics and biology to technology and astronomy, the exhibits cover a diverse range of scientific disciplines, providing a hands-on approach to education. It's a fantastic place for families, students, and curious minds to explore the wonders of science in an interactive manner. The Planetarium, with its state-of-the-art facilities, offers a mesmerizing journey through the cosmos. The celestial shows are not only educational but also awe-inspiring, leaving visitors with a newfound appreciation for the vastness of the universe. The immersive experience under the dome is truly a highlight and a must-see for anyone interested in astronomy. The staff at the Goa Science Centre and Planetarium are knowledgeable and friendly, adding to the overall positive experience. They are more than willing to share insights and answer questions, making the visit both educational and enjoyable. The well-maintained premises, coupled with the thoughtful curation of exhibits and shows, create an environment that fosters curiosity and learning. The Goa Science Centre and Planetarium are not just places to visit; they are gateways to understanding the world around us and beyond. In conclusion, if you're in Goa and have an interest in science and astronomy, the Goa Science Centre and Planetarium are a must-visit. It's a journey that sparks curiosity, ignites imagination, and provides a deeper understanding of the marvels of the universe. Five stars for an enriching experience!

3 D show and Planetarium show are just below avarage. Video quality is absurd. In these times when even cheaper smart phones boast excellent megapixel videos quality, these shows are decade too old. Disappointed. I make it a point to visit Science and Planetarium of the cities I visit. Sadly this one is wastage of time and money. It could have been so much better. Pros : Oceanic section and mirrors section are only saving grace of this so called science place Cons : 1. Dirty , smelly seats, I don't know when last it was cleaned. Sweat smell is ingrained in it's fibre. Nauseous experience. ( In Planetarium show) 2. Poor poor video quality of so called 3 D Dolphin show , where no fish were distinguishable. It was completely night time with obscure screen .. 3. Only security guards were present though it was weekday. No one I mean no one to give information or make kids understand what was what. Never experienced this ever before.

Goa Science Centre is located on New Marine Highway, Miramar, Panjim. Initial work on the construction for this building started in 1999 and took two and a half years to finish. Goa Science Centre is a division of the National Council of Science Museums(NCSM), which is a project headed by the Ministry of Culture to set up multiple science learning centres all of India.
